National Guard Bureau

Federal agency responsible for the administration of the United States National Guard

2024 The National Defense Authorization Act amended the previous act and elevated the vice chief to a statutory rank of general.
October 2 2024 General Steven Nordhaus assumed command as the Chief of the National Guard Bureau, taking over the top leadership position.
2017 The National Defense Authorization Act removed the vice chief's statutory rank.
2013 Company A, 3d Battalion, 238th Aviation Regiment mobilized for Operation Enduring Freedom in Kuwait.
2013 153d Military Police Company deployed in support of Operation Enduring Freedom.
2012 The National Defense Authorization Act renamed the position back to vice chief of the National Guard Bureau and elevated the office to a three-star general.
November 2010 Company A, 3d Battalion, 238th Aviation Regiment mobilized for Afghanistan Operation Enduring Freedom XI.
April 18 2010 262d Maintenance Company returned to Delaware and released from active duty.
February 2010 During 'Operation Arctic Vengeance I and II', over 300 DEARNG Soldiers supported the State of Emergency declared by Gov. Jack Markell following snowstorms, completing over 250 missions assisting local and state agencies.
January 2010 Embedded Training Team (ETT) of eleven Delaware Army National Guard Soldiers mobilized for pre-deployment training.
